In this week’s edition of the weekly recap, Sam Bankman-Fried appeared to implement a documented media playbook from prison, former SafeMoon CEO Braden Karony received a 100-month sentence, and Strategy introduced perpetual preferred shares to fund Bitcoin purchases. Bankman-Fried executes…
